Camphor / menthol / methyl salicylate topical has an average rating of 7.3 out of 10 from a total of 3 ratings on Drugs.com. 67% of reviewers reported a positive effect, while 33% reported a negative effect. |
Lidocaine topical has an average rating of 4.4 out of 10 from a total of 248 ratings on Drugs.com. 31% of reviewers reported a positive effect, while 54% reported a negative effect. |
